It was a proper cat-fight when Capital faced off against Princeton on Tuesday. The Cougars fell 2-0 to the Tigers. Capital haven't had much luck with Princeton recently, as the team has come up short the last three times they've met.
Capital now has a losing record of 7-8-2. As for Princeton, their victory was their third straight at home, which pushed their record up to 10-5-2.
Capital has already played their next match, a 7-0 win against Logan on the 16th. As for Princeton, they also wasted no time getting back out on the pitch and have already played their next contest, a 2-0 loss against George Washington on the 16th.
